Warning Signs You Need Water Damage Reconstruction in Gulf, NC
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Don’t wait until it’s too late, be aware of these common signs of water damage: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Unpleasant smells can show hidden moisture in your walls, ceilings, or floors. Don’t assume it’s just a normal household odor, investigate the source and address it quickly.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Water damage can cause flooring to warp, buckle, or even collapse. Don’t walk on it it’s a safety hazard and can lead to further damage.
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ls
Visible water stains can show a leak or hidden moisture issue. Don’t ignore it address the problem before it gets worse.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Water damage can cause paint or wallpaper to peel, bubble, or flake. Don’t try to cover it up it’s a sign of a deeper issue.
Mold or Mildew Growth
Mold and mildew can grow in damp environments, posing health risks to you and your family. Don’t risk it address the issue quickly.
Increased Utility Bills
Unusual increases in your utility bills can show hidden moisture issues or leaks. Investigate the source and address it before it gets worse.

Water Damage Reconstruction Cost in Gulf, NC
The cost of water damage reconstruction in Gulf, NC, varies depending on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ates range from $500 to $2,500 or more, depending on the scope of the job. Get a free estimate today and let us help you understand the costs involved.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$1,500 | Size of affected area, amount of water extracted |
| Repair and reconstruction of damaged materials | $1,000 – $3,000 | Type of materials, extent of damage |
| Removal and disposal of damaged materials | $500 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ials |
| Dehumidification and drying equipment rental | $200 – $500 | Duration of rental, type of equipment |
| Insurance claims documentation and processing | $0 – $500 | Complexity of claim, insurance company requirements |
